Python播放视频

安装opencv

1
pip install opencv-python

如果使用以下方式安装,则安装opencv2,只能在python2.7下使用

1
sudo apt-get install python-opencv

导入

1
2
3
>>> import cv2
>>> cv2.__version__
'3.4.1'

播放视频

这样只有声音

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
import pyglet
import os
window=pyglet.window.Window(caption='my player')
player=pyglet.media.Player()
source=pyglet.media.load('./sound/movie.flv',streaming=False)
player.play()
@window.event
def on_draw():
window.clear()
player.get_texture().blit(0,0)
pyglet.app.run()